In an atom, the neutrons and protons are made up of up quarks and down quarks. Strange quarks, charms quarks, top quarks, and bottom quarks also exist, but do not play as much of a role in the structure of an atom.

The Wikipedia article on Color-flavor locking says: "Color–flavor locking (CFL) is a phenomenon that is expected to occur in ultra-high-density strange matter, a form of quark matter. The quarks form Cooper pairs, whose color properties are correlated with their flavor properties in a one-to-one correspondence between three color pairs and three flavor pairs. ..."You really can't understand much about this if any simpler words are used - to have any understanding at all of what's going on, you really need to know, at the very least, what a "color" is (as used for quarks), and what a "flavor" is (again, as used for quarks) - basically, these are fancy names for certain properties that quarks have.
